Heroin worth Rs 1.5 crore seized, 2 held
Varanasi, Sep 2 (UNI) Police in neighouring Chandauli district today arrested two drug peddlars from Mughalsarai railway station and seized heroin valued at Rs 1.5 crore in international market.
On being tipped off, Dinesh Gupta and Hasim, both residents of Badayun district of West Uttar Pradesh were held outside the railway station and 1.5 kg heroin was seized from their possession, Police Superintendent (Chandauli) Pravin Kumar told UNI here.
The two drug peddlars who were arrested after detraining from Ranchi-Varanasi Intercity Express were carrying the narcotic consignment from Bihar to West UP.
The SP announced a cash reward of Rs 2,500 for the police team that accomplished the major catch.
